This video provides a practical demonstration of disassembling a Ruger Mini-14 tactical rifle for cleaning. The presenter emphasizes the importance of regular firearm maintenance, especially for long guns, and details the process which can be accomplished with a single screwdriver. The guide covers the main components to be separated and reassembled, highlighting the satisfaction of a well-maintained firearm.

Quick Summary

Disassembling and cleaning your Ruger Mini-14 tactical rifle is essential for maintaining optimal performance. The process can be simplified with just one screwdriver to separate components like the frame, bolt, and barrel receiver assembly. Using products like Ballistol aids in removing grime and residue effectively.

Frequently Asked Questions

What tools are needed to disassemble a Ruger Mini-14 tactical rifle?

According to the video, the Ruger Mini-14 tactical version can be disassembled with just one screwdriver. This simple tool is sufficient for separating the main components for cleaning and maintenance.

How often should a Ruger Mini-14 tactical rifle be fully disassembled for cleaning?

The presenter suggests that a full disassembly for cleaning might not be necessary for about six months, but this frequency depends on how often the firearm is shot. Regular cleaning after use is still recommended.

What cleaning product is recommended for the Ruger Mini-14 in this video?

The video mentions using Ballistol for cleaning the Ruger Mini-14. It's described as a product that makes spraying down and wiping all components nice and simple.

Why is it important to disassemble and clean a Ruger Mini-14?

Disassembling and cleaning your firearm, especially long guns like the Ruger Mini-14, is crucial to remove built-up grime and residue. This maintenance ensures optimal performance and prevents potential issues, especially if corrosive ammunition has been used.
